Output 70d1da311771e04d7629993c86c460bc5ae11632ff0607b01085232296306e3d:0

value
2539292
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 04aa2ba0a7a89edb26b96a51ae2303677b4966c1 OP_EQUALVERIFY OP_CHECKSIG
address
1RfZR6PmkaCGnZAjnbhxbeaGa1WJJz9yz
transaction
70d1da311771e04d7629993c86c460bc5ae11632ff0607b01085232296306e3d
spent
true